Randal Kolo Muani remains Juventus’ top attacking target, and the Bianconeri’s hopes of securing a deal are still alive, as the Frenchman is reportedly training with PSG’s U19 team.

French striker Kolo Muani is not part of PSG’s plans as he’s training with their U19 team, according to Fabrizio Romano .

Juventus given hope after PSG decision on Kolo Muani PHILADELPHIA, PENNSYLVANIA – JUNE 22: Randal Kolo Muani #20 of Juventus FC looks on during the FIFA Club World Cup 2025 group G match between Juventus FC and Wydad AC at Lincoln Financial Field on June 22, 2025 in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ania. (Photo by Francois Nel/Getty Images) Juventus’ interest in Randal Kolo Muani is well established, with the French forward remaining the club’s top attacking target for the 2026 summer transfer window.

The Bianconeri are working to bring him back to Turin after he spent the second half of the 2024-25 season on loan at the Allianz Stadium.

Both Kolo Muani and Renato Sanches resumed training with PSG on Friday, but the club has already pushed them to the U19 squad, telling them to find a new club for next season.

Juventus have been struggling to reach an agreement with PSG, so they are also focusing on alternative targets, including Parma’s Mateo Pellegrino.

According to multiple sources, PSG demand €55m for Kolo Muani, while Juventus’ best proposal so far was worth €35m.
